SUMMARY Somatic chromosome numbers of nineteen species of African Sapotaceae have been determined. Species of the genera Pachystela, Donella, Gambeya and Omphalocarpum have 2n = 28, those of Synsepalum (except for the polyploid species S. subcordatum , 2n = 112), Tridesmostemon, Autranella, Tieghemella have 2n = 26, whereas Baillonella toxisperma has 2n = 24 chromosomes. It is concluded that 2n = 28 presents the most primitive number, whereas 2n = 26 and 2n = 24, like the polyploid numbers, are secundary.
